  • The Marine Corps and the Navy trace their origins to the same moment in U.S. history—a series of decisions made in fall 1775. On 10 November of that year, the Second Continental Congress, which represented American colonists in the struggle against British rule, took the momentous step of authorizing two battalions of “American Marines.”  Yet if the impetus was anti-British, the model was Britain’s own “maritime regiment of foot,” the forerunner to today’s Royal Marines. The American Marines, like their British counterparts, operated on and near the shore—the perilous space between the sea (a Navy’s purview) and the field (an army’s), where the exigencies of coastal warfare created the need for a specialized force.  With the successful end of the Revolutionary War in 1783, however, the American Marines ceased to exist and did not return (as the “United States Marine Corps”) until the late 1790s, when Congress reestablished the U.S. Navy. Once again, Navy and Marine Corps history converged.  Since the 1790s, the Navy has done little without the involvement of the Marine Corps. From hanging by the rigging in order to sweep enemy decks with fire in the War of 1812 to storming Japanese strongholds in the Pacific during World War II, Marines have fought alongside and as a complement to Navy personnel.   • On 18 June 1812, the United States formally declared war on Great Britain due to that nation’s continued attempts to restrict trade on the high seas, the Royal Navy’s impressment of American seamen, and the United States’ desire to expand territory. During the War of 1812, fighting on land and at sea took place in several theaters of operations to include the Old Northwest (Ohio, Illinois, Indiana, Michigan, Wisconsin, and Upper Canada), along the river corridors of the Niagara, St. Lawrence, and Lake Champlain-Richelieu, along coastal Maine, in the Chesapeake Bay, on the Gulf Coast, and on the high seas. In the first several years of the war, in contrast to the setbacks experienced by U.S. land forces, the American Navy secured notable victories in the Atlantic and on the Great Lakes, while Britain was forced to concentrate its efforts on the ongoing war with France. However, when French Emperor Napoleon Bonaparte’s armies were defeated in April 1814, Britain turned its full attention on the United States. On 24 August 1814, after defeating American forces at the Battle of Bladensburg, British troops marched into Washington, DC. There, they set multiple government buildings, include the Capitol and the White House, on fire. Commodore Thomas Tingey, commandant of the Washington Navy Yard, saw smoke rising from the Capitol and ordered the strategically valuable yard burned to prevent it from falling into enemy hands.
